WebSep 7, 2024 · If you have kidney disease or kidney failure, your doctor may have prescribed a diet to lower creatinine levels. Creatinine is a byproduct of the metabolism of creatine in muscle and the breakdown of protein from the foods you eat. With normal kidney function, your kidneys filter creatinine from your blood and excrete it through your urine. WebDec 20, 2024 · What Is the Normal BUN Level Range?
